Importance of Tire Size

The stock tire size of 265/70R16 is not just a random number; it’s a carefully chosen specification that balances comfort, handling, and off-road capability. Here’s why it matters:

  • Off-Road Capability: The wider tire provides better traction on loose surfaces like mud, sand, and gravel.
  • Load Bearing: With a load index of 113, these tires can support a significant amount of weight, making them suitable for hauling and towing.
  • Comfort and Stability: The aspect ratio of 70 indicates a taller sidewall, which helps absorb shocks from rough terrains, providing a smoother ride.

Aftermarket Considerations

If you’re considering upgrading your tires, it’s crucial to choose sizes that maintain the overall performance of your Tacoma. Here are a few points to keep in mind:

  • Compatibility: Ensure any new tire size fits within the wheel well without rubbing against the suspension or body.
  • Performance: Larger tires can improve ground clearance but may affect fuel efficiency and handling.
  • Legal Regulations: Check local laws regarding tire sizes and modifications to ensure compliance.

Choosing the Right Tire

When selecting tires for your Tacoma TRD Pro, consider the following factors:

Driving Conditions

– If you frequently drive in wet or snowy conditions, opt for tires with superior wet traction and a tread pattern designed for those conditions.
– For off-road enthusiasts, look for tires with aggressive tread patterns that provide better grip on loose surfaces.

Performance Needs

– Determine whether you prioritize comfort on the highway, durability for off-road adventures, or a balance of both.
– Some tires are designed for specific driving styles, so choose one that aligns with how you plan to use your Tacoma.

Budget

– Tire prices can vary significantly. Set a budget and look for options that offer the best value for your needs.
– Remember that investing in quality tires can save you money in the long run through better performance and longevity.
